Volodymyr #Zelenskyy commemorates Hetman Pylyp Orlyk on Ukraine's Constitution Day

The document concluded in 1710, which went down in history as the #Constitution of Pylyp Orlyk, is considered the first European constitution in its modern sense.

It defines the concept of a free nation, the foundations of democracy and justice, and anti-corruption and social principles

Ahead of Juneteenth, congressional lawmakers again seek to remove exception for slavery from US Constitution | CNN Politics (www.cnn.com)

A group of Democratic lawmakers has reintroduced a joint resolution to negate a clause in the 13th Amendment of the Constitution that permits slavery or involuntary servitude “as a punishment for crime.”

My home city of #AuroraIllinois tried to back out of their contract to hold a #PrideParade in 2022, because parade organizers had asked officers in the parade route to not wear their uniforms. Some #BlueLivesMatter feelings were hurt, so a lot of officers tried to back out of providing security for the event (they were being paid overtime to provide the security).

With too few officers agreeing to provide security for overtime, the parade faced cancellation. After a great deal of local uproar in support of the parade, things were worked out last-minute. But the questions raised by the disagreement have since gone on to be a Federal Court case.

On Friday, a Federal Judge ruled temporarily in favor of the #Pride group hosting the event, saying that sections of the City's permit process likely violates the #Constitution. This ruling now allows this year's parade to go definitively forward.
